;; The encoding used internally. This encoding is meant to be able to save
|
||||
;; any multibyte buffer without losing information. It can change between
|
||||
;; Emacs releases, tho, so should only be used for internal files.
|
||||
(define-coding-system-alias 'emacs-internal 'utf-8-emacs-unix)
